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ions Frigate version 0.17.1
Description An issue exists where the 'GET /api/logs/{service}' endpoint allows any authenticated user, including those with the viewer role, to download Frigate and nginx logs. This exposure includes auto-generated admin passwords and camera credentials contained within request query strings, which can lead to privilege escalation from a viewer to an administrator.
Recommendations At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this vulnerability.
